Gabrielle Clifton of Boonville named to spring Deans’ List at Nebraska

Gabrielle Paige Clifton, hailing from Boonville, has been named to the Deans’ List at the University of Nebraska-Lincoln for the spring 2025-26 academic year. This recognition reflects her strong performance and dedication to academic excellence.
